CCTV, Tracking and Employee Data
Monitoring — whether through CCTV, vehicle tracking or software that logs activity — involves personal data and must be handled lawfully and fairly, especially when it concerns staff.
This is general guidance; monitoring at work is a sensitive area where specific advice is often worthwhile.
Be Transparent
People should know they are being monitored, why, and what happens to the recordings. Hidden or covert monitoring is only justifiable in rare, serious circumstances.
Keep It Proportionate
- Monitor only what is necessary for a clear purpose.
- Avoid capturing private areas or excessive detail.
- Limit who can view footage or logs.
- Set a short, justified retention period.
Assess the Impact
Systematic monitoring usually warrants a data protection impact assessment to weigh the business need against the intrusion into people's privacy.
Frequently Asked Questions
Can I monitor staff emails?
Only with a clear, justified reason, a policy that staff are aware of, and the least intrusive method that achieves your aim.
